The odd functions are f(x)=x⁵-3x³+2x and f(x)=1÷x.

Given functions are f(x)=x³-x², f(x)=x⁵-3x³+2x, f(x)=4x+9 and f(x)=1÷x.

A function is said to be odd function if and only if: f(-x) = -f(x)

For every value of x in its domain.

1. f(x)=x³-x²

Substituting -x in this, we get

f(-x)=(-x)³-(-x)²

f(-x)=-x³-x²

From above we see that

f(-x)≠-f(x)

So, this function is not odd.

2. f(x)=x⁵-3x³+2x

Substituting -x in this, we get

f(-x)=(-x)⁵-3(-x)³+2(-x)

f(-x)=-x⁵+3x³-2x

f(-x)=-(x⁵-3x³+2x)

From above we see that

f(-x)=-f(x)

So, this function is odd

3. f(x)=4x+9

Substituting -x in this, we get

f(-x)=4(-x)+9

f(-x)=-4x+9

From above we see that

f(-x)≠-f(x)

So, this function is not odd.

4. f(x)=1÷x

Substituting -x in this, we get

f(-x)=1÷(-x)

f(-x)=-(1÷x)

From above we see that

f(-x)=-f(x)

So, this function is odd.

Hence, the function f(x)=f(x)=x³-x² is not odd, f(x)=x⁵-3x³+2x is odd, f(x)=4x+9 is not odd and f(x)=1÷x is odd.
